    < Back Indian Okra (Bhindi) Indian varieties of okra are an attractive dark green, with fruits that remain tender longer. The average fruit size is 3.5-4 inches and the average fruit weight is 9-10gm. Fruits are shiny, smooth and easy to pick. Good field adaptability with dark green fruits and foliage. This variety is preferred mostly in UK, but quickly expanding its preference in USA. Indian okra, commonly referred to as " bhindi, " is a beloved vegetable in Indian cuisine. It's used in a variety of flavorful dishes, such as Bhindi Masala , a stir-fry with onions, tomatoes, and spices, or Kurkuri Bhindi , a crispy fried version that's irresistibly crunchy. Okra is also featured in curries like Bagara Bhindi , which combines tangy tamarind and aromatic spices.     < Back Chinese Bitter Melon Chinese bitter melon, also known as Momordica charantia , is a unique vegetable widely used in Asian cuisine. It has a warty, elongated shape and a pale green color. Taste : While still bitter, it's slightly less intense than the Indian variety, making it more palatable for some.     < Back American Okra (Clemson) Our American Okra pods can grow up to 9″ long, but are best harvested at about 3 – 4 inches for culinary use, the pods are dark green, straight, and slightly grooved. Clemson Spineless is a highly popular variety of okra, known for its smooth, spineless pods and vigorous growth. Clemson Spineless okra has a mild, slightly grassy flavor with a hint of nuttiness, which becomes more pronounced when cooked. American okra, also known as gumbo or lady's fingers, is a versatile vegetable often featured in dishes like gumbo, stews, and fried preparations Health Benefit Rich in Nutrients : Okra is high in vitamins C, K, and A, as well as minerals like magnesium and potassium.     < Back Long Squash Long squash, also known as opo squash , calabash , or bottle gourd , is a versatile vegetable widely used in Asian, Mediterranean, and Caribbean cuisines. It has a long, cylindrical shape with smooth, pale green skin and tender white flesh. Taste : Mild and neutral, similar to zucchini or cucumber. It absorbs flavors well, making it ideal for soups, stir-fries, and curries.     < Back Indian Bitter Melon Indian Bitter melon (also known as Momordica charantia or Bitter Gourd) is a tropical vine from the gourd family which is known for its distinctively bitter taste and numerous health benefits. Taste : True to its name, it has a strong bitter flavor, which can be reduced by salting or parboiling before cooking.     < Back Thai Eggplant Thai eggplants, also known as makhuea pro in Thailand, are small, round vegetables that are a staple in Southeast Asian cuisine. They belong to the species Solanum melongena and are part of the nightshade family, which includes tomatoes and potatoes. Taste : They have a mild, slightly bitter flavor and a crunchy texture when raw. When cooked, they soften and absorb the flavors of the dish.     < Back Chinese Eggplant Chinese eggplant, also known as Asian eggplant , is a long, slender variety of eggplant with vibrant purple skin and tender white flesh. It's a popular ingredient in Chinese cuisine due to its mild, slightly sweet flavor and ability to absorb sauces and seasonings beautifully. Taste : Milder and sweeter than globe eggplants, with a creamy texture when cooked. Health benefit: Rich in Antioxidants : Contains nasunin, a powerful antioxidant found in its purple skin. This compound helps protect brain cells from oxidative stress and may support cognitive health.     < Back Fuzzy Squash Fuzzy squash, also known as mo qua or hairy gourd , is a type of gourd closely related to winter melon. It gets its name from the fine, hair-like fuzz that covers its green skin. Taste : Mild and slightly sweet, making it versatile for various dishes.
